WebRubber elasticity refers to a property of crosslinked rubber: it can be stretched by up to a factor of 10 from its original length and, when released, returns very nearly to its original length. This can be repeated many times with no apparent degradation to the rubber. WebThe thermal deformation of HDPE with an aggregating disperse filler was experimentally studied in a wide range of temperatures. The effect of the filler on the characteristics of relaxation transitions in HDPE, determined from dilatometric tests, was analyzed. Skilled in small molecule … how to soften hard thick toenailsWebThe thermal expansion behaviour of a series of 1D coordination polymers has been investigated. Variation of the metal centre allows tuning of the thermal expansion behaviour from colossal positive volumetric to extreme anomalous thermal expansion.
